6. FAQs: Your Burning Questions Answered
What alternatives can I use instead of shrimp in this garlic shrimp avocado crostini appetizer?
For a vegetarian-friendly variation, explore options like grilled vegetables or seasoned chickpeas as a delightful substitute for shrimp. These alternatives provide a similar texture and absorb the garlic flavor beautifully.
Is it possible to prepare this garlic shrimp appetizer ahead of time?
While you can certainly prepare the individual components in advance, it’s highly recommended to assemble the crostini right before serving. This ensures that the bread retains its desired crispiness and the avocado maintains its fresh appearance.
Which type of bread works best for creating the crostini?
A freshly baked baguette stands out as the top choice, thanks to its wonderfully crispy exterior and soft, airy interior. Alternatively, you can also use Italian bread or ciabatta for a slightly different, yet equally delicious, texture.

Garlic Shrimp Crostini with Avocado: A Flavorful Bite-Sized Delight
- Author: Serena Miller
- Total Time: 20 minutes
- Yield: 12 servings 1x
- Diet: Gluten-Free
Description
Garlic Shrimp Crostini with Avocado is a delicious appetizer combining succulent shrimp, aromatic garlic, and creamy avocado on crisp baguette slices. Perfect for parties and gatherings, this dish is sure to impress!
Ingredients
- 1 baguette, sliced into 1/2 inch pieces
- 1 pound sh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 ripe avocados
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ions
- Minced the garlic to release its flavor.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at, add garlic and sauté for 1 minute. Then, add shrimp and cook for 3-4 minutes until pink and opaque.
- Cut avocados, remove pits, and scoop the flesh into a bowl. Mash gently with a fork, seasoning with salt and pepper.
- Toast baguette slices until golden brown. Top each slice with mashed avocado and cooked shrimp. Garnish with fresh parsley.
Notes
- Enjoy the crostini immediately for optimal freshness.
- Store shrimp and mashed avocado separately in airtight containers in the fridge for up to 24 hours.
- This dish pairs well with white wine or light cocktails.
